Understanding Rubber Keypads and Their Performance

Rubber keypads, important components in several digital tools, work as the primary interface for customer interaction. Consisted of elastomer products, these keypads offer tactile responses and longevity, making them suitable for different applications. They are composed of multiple layers, including a conductive layer that completes the circuit upon crucial activation, making certain reliable efficiency. The layout commonly includes raised switches, which assist in simplicity of usage and access, especially in environments where users could wear gloves or have restricted dexterity.

Rubber keypads are resistant to wetness, dirt, and chemicals, enhancing their durability and dependability in varied settings. Their personalization possible allows manufacturers to develop one-of-a-kind designs and designs tailored to certain customer demands. This functionality not only improves customer experience however additionally enables seamless assimilation throughout tools, strengthening the relevance of rubber keypads in modern-day innovation. On the whole, their convenience and usefulness make them crucial elements in the electronic landscape.

Sturdiness and Environmental Resistance of Rubber Keypads

Keypads made from rubber are renowned for their remarkable longevity and durability in various ecological problems. These keypads are developed to endure extreme temperature levels, moisture, and exposure to UV light, making them an optimal selection for outdoor and industrial applications. Their inherent versatility allows them to absorb shocks and influences, reducing the danger of damage from unintended drops or misuse. Additionally, rubber keypads are resistant to oils and chemicals, making certain long life even in rough workplace. This toughness converts into reduced upkeep expenses their website and less substitutes, improving general user experience. Moreover, their ability to maintain functionality despite exposure to dirt and particles makes them appropriate for a myriad of industries, including vehicle, medical, and customer electronics. As a result, the robust nature of rubber keypads plays an important function in guaranteeing reliability and performance, eventually contributing to user contentment across various industries.

What Materials Are Frequently Utilized in Rubber Keypad Production?

Common products utilized in rubber keypad manufacturing consist of silicone, polyurethane, and thermoplastic elastomers. These materials give sturdiness, versatility, and responsive responses, making them ideal for numerous applications in electronic devices and commercial tools.
